* pcie/layerscape: fix bug in bus number computation when setting msi-mapBogdan Purcareata2016-06-031-3/+6
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| When multiple PCI cards are present in an ls2080a board, the second card does not get its msi-map set up properly due to a bug in computing the bus number. The bus number returned by PCI_BDF() is not the actual PCI bus number, but instead represents a global u-boot PCI bus number. A given bus number is relative to hose->first_busno, so that has to be subtracted from the PCI device id. * pci/layerscape: set LUT and msi-map for discovered PCI devicesStuart Yoder2016-03-211-0/+147
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| msi-map properties are used to tell an OS how PCI requester IDs are mapped to ARM SMMU stream IDs. for all PCI devices discovered in a system: -allocate a LUT (look-up-table) entry in that PCI controller -allocate a stream ID for the device -program and enable a LUT entry (maps PCI requester id to stream ID) -set the msi-map property on the controller reflecting the LUT mapping basic bus scanning loop/logic was taken from drivers/pci/pci.c pci_hose_scan_bus().
